What are the main differences between horse meat and fireweed?
- Horse meat is richer in vitamin B12, iron, and selenium, yet fireweed is richer in manganese, vitamin A, fiber, calcium, magnesium, and vitamin B6.
- Fireweed's daily need coverage for manganese is 291% higher.
- Fireweed contains less cholesterol.
We used Game meat, horse, cooked, roasted and Fireweed, leaves, raw types in this comparison.
